A new report from the agency charged with overseeing AmericaÃÛÁÄÖ±²¥™s energy system warns that soaring electricity demand is outstripping supply, and current energy policies driving more power plants into retirement are making the problem worse.

The North American Electric Reliability Corp. (NERC) recently released its updated Long-Term Reliability Assessment, and its analysis is dire. The combination of increased electrification of power demand and the retirement of baseload power generation from coal and nuclear is creating a possibility that power demand will outstrip supply.
